Stagwell Inc is a challenger network using AI to deliver marketing and advertising solutions to its clients. It operates in five reportable segments: Marketing Services, Digital Transformation, Media and Commerce, Communications, and The Marketing Cloud. Maximum revenue is generated from the Marketing Services segment, which offers social media solutions, designs breakthrough brand campaigns, and creates immersive experiential marketing programs and social engagement strategies, helping clients connect with audiences across digital platforms. The various brands operating under this segment include 72 and Sunny, Anomaly, NRG, Harris Insights, TEAM, and Movers & Shaker. Geographically, the company generates maximum revenue from the United States, followed by the UK and other countries.
